Alabama Did What Alabama Does To Oklahoma
Yahoo News ^ | 12-30-2018

Posted on 12/30/2018 8:33:17 AM PST by blam

In Saturday’s first 17 minutes of game time, Alabama reeled off 28 straight points to knock down Oklahoma before anyone at the Orange Bowl had a chance to buy a second beer. That early lead proved to be the cushion Alabama needed to coast to an easy, if not entirely calm, victory in Miami. The final score flatters the Sooners a bit, since the Crimson Tide ended up winning by only 11 points, with a final score of 45-34.

The early barrage was a prime example of what Alabama does to pretty much anyone not named Georgia or Clemson; they hit fast and hard and jump out to huge leads before their opponents even get settled into the game.

Oklahoma first made it interesting in the second quarter, with Heisman Trophy winner Kyler Murray driving the Sooners down the field for their first score, a two-yard scamper by Trey Sermon. Oklahoma would go on to tack on a field goal later in the quarter, though they also allowed Alabama to get a field goal of their own before half.

The second half was a souped-up version of the second quarter, as Oklahoma first closed the gap to 11 points late in the third, thanks to a beastly 49-yard throw from Murray to Charleston Rambo:

However, the Tide immediately responded with a crowd-quieting 75-yard touchdown drive, as quarterback Tua Tagovailoa picked apart the Oklahoma defense with his trademark precision passing (25-27, 318 yards). Oklahoma would close the lead to 11 twice more in the fourth quarter, but Alabama was ready for the Sooners’ surge, responding with a quick five play drive to push the score to 45-27, before running out the clock on the shoulders of star running back Josh Jacobs.(Tua took a 'knee' twice at the goal line)

Tide Wins First Orange Bowl In 52 Years

"With the Tide’s victory over Oklahoma, Alabama avenged its 2013 loss to the Sooners and now moves to 2-3-1 all-time against OU. The Tide also moved to 5-4 all time in the Orange Bowl. It was a bowl game Alabama had not won since 1966, including some heartbreaking losses in that span against Notre Dame (1975) and Michigan (2000).
In fairness, Alabama has rarely made Orange Bowl appearances in the previous 40 years, but last night’s physical domination of the Big 12 champs did remove a lot of the bad taste from the fan base’s collective palates. "
